반응형
* 참고 교재 : 혼자 공부하는 데이터 분석 (한빛미디어)
함수 / 메서드 | 기능 |
json.dumps() | 파이썬 객체를 JSON 문자열로 변환 |
json.loads() | JSON 문자열을 파이썬 객체로 변환 |
pandas.read_json() | JSON 문자열을 판다스 시리즈나 데이터프레임으로 변환 |
pandas.DataFrame() | list 를 판다스 데이터프레임으로 변환 |
- JSON 은 파이썬의 딕셔너리 (dictionary) 와 리스트 (list) 를 중첩해 놓은 것과 비슷함
- 아래 같은 방법으로 JSON 형식을 이용해 파이썬 딕셔너리를 만들 수 있음
json 패키지 사용 (import json)
- 파이썬 객체를 json 문자열로 변환하기
- json.dumps() 사용
- json 문자열을 파이썬 객체 (딕셔너리) 로 변환
- json.loads() 사용
Pandas 를 사용해서 json 포맷 다루기
- json 문자열을 Pandas 데이터프레임으로 변환하기
- pd.read_json() 를 사용해서 json 문자열을 데이터프레임으로 변환
- pd.DataFrame() 을 사용해서 list 를 데이터프레임으로 변환
끝.
반응형
'개발 Dev > 데이터 분석' 카테고리의 다른 글
[데이터분석/파이썬] requests와 Bueatiful Soup를 이용해서 웹 크롤링하기: yes24에서 책 페이지 수 가져오기 (1) | 2023.07.16 |
---|---|
[데이터분석/파이썬] 도서 정보 OpenAPI 사용하기 (도서관 정보나루) (0) | 2023.07.13 |
[데이터분석/파이썬] XML 포맷 다루는 방법 (xml.etree.ElementTree, 판다스 read_xml) (0) | 2023.07.09 |
[데이터분석/파이썬] csv 파일을 Pandas 데이터프레임으로 읽기 / 데이터프레임을 csv 파일에 쓰기 (0) | 2023.07.09 |
[데이터분석/파이썬] gdown 으로 구글 드라이브에 저장된 csv 파일 읽어오기 (gdown, chardet) (0) | 2023.07.08 |